Mystery over £5m will of farmer who shot burglar

MOURNERS will file into the crematorium for the funeral of Tony Martin today not knowing who among them will inherit his estate, said to be worth up to £5million.

The farmer, who spent three years in jail after shooting dead a burglar at his home in 1999, leaves an estate which includes the now-notorious Bleak House farm, the land around it, property in Australia, as well as his cars.

The will is yet to be read following 80-year-old Martin's death from the effects of a stroke earlier this month at his cottage near Wisbech, Cambs.

imageHe had no partner or children but his estranged brother, long-term housekeeper as well as nieces and cousins are all expected to be present at today's funeral in King's Lynn, Norfolk, and they may be beneficiaries of his will.

A source close to the family told the Mirror: "No one knows where Tony's money will end up.

"His estate is worth around £4m to £5m and no one knows where money from Bleak House and all the land he owned is going. He was a very frugal man, not interested in money.
